首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何正确声明上传到Firebase的字符串?

在Firebase中正确声明上传字符串的方法是使用Firebase Realtime Database或Firebase Cloud Firestore。这两个服务都可以用于存储和同步数据。

  1. 使用Firebase Realtime Database:
    • 概念:Firebase Realtime Database是一个实时的、云端的NoSQL数据库,可以存储和同步数据。
    • 分类:属于实时数据库类别。
    • 优势:实时同步、简单易用、可扩展性强。
    • 应用场景:适用于需要实时同步数据的应用,如聊天应用、实时协作工具等。
    • 推荐的腾讯云相关产品:腾讯云数据库TDSQL、腾讯云云数据库Redis版。
    • 产品介绍链接地址:腾讯云数据库TDSQL腾讯云云数据库Redis版
  2. 使用Firebase Cloud Firestore:
    • 概念:Firebase Cloud Firestore是一个灵活的、云端的NoSQL文档数据库,可以存储和同步数据。
    • 分类:属于文档数据库类别。
    • 优势:实时同步、支持复杂查询、可扩展性强。
    • 应用场景:适用于需要存储和查询结构化数据的应用,如社交媒体应用、电子商务应用等。
    • 推荐的腾讯云相关产品:腾讯云数据库MongoDB版、腾讯云云数据库CDB版。
    • 产品介绍链接地址:腾讯云数据库MongoDB版腾讯云云数据库CDB版

在Firebase中正确声明上传字符串的步骤如下:

  1. 引入Firebase SDK:根据所选的开发平台,引入适当的Firebase SDK。
  2. 初始化Firebase:使用Firebase SDK初始化Firebase项目。
  3. 获取数据库引用:通过Firebase SDK获取对Realtime Database或Cloud Firestore的引用。
  4. 声明上传字符串:使用数据库引用,将字符串上传到指定的数据库路径或集合中。

示例代码(使用Firebase Realtime Database):

代码语言:javascript
复制
// 引入Firebase SDK
const firebase = require('firebase/app');
require('firebase/database');

// 初始化Firebase
const firebaseConfig = {
  // Firebase配置信息
};
firebase.initializeApp(firebaseConfig);

// 获取数据库引用
const database = firebase.database();

// 声明上传字符串
const stringRef = database.ref('path/to/string');
stringRef.set('Hello, Firebase!');

示例代码(使用Firebase Cloud Firestore):

代码语言:javascript
复制
// 引入Firebase SDK
const firebase = require('firebase/app');
require('firebase/firestore');

// 初始化Firebase
const firebaseConfig = {
  // Firebase配置信息
};
firebase.initializeApp(firebaseConfig);

// 获取数据库引用
const firestore = firebase.firestore();

// 声明上传字符串
const stringRef = firestore.collection('collection').doc('document');
stringRef.set({ string: 'Hello, Firebase!' });

请注意,以上示例代码仅为演示如何正确声明上传字符串到Firebase,并不包含完整的错误处理和其他功能。在实际开发中,建议根据具体需求进行适当的扩展和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 在 ASP.NET Core 中使用 AI 驱动的授权策略限制站点访问

    ASP.NET Core 引入声明授权机制,该机制接受自定义策略来限制对应用程序或部分应用程序的访问,具体取决于经过身份验证的用户的特定授权属性。在上一篇文章中,即于 2019 年 6 月发行的 MSDN 杂志中的《ASP.NET Core 中支持 AI 的生物识别安全》(msdn.com/magazine/mt833460),我提出了一个基于策略的模型,用于将授权逻辑与基础用户角色分离,并展示了在检测到未经授权的入侵时,如何专门使用此类授权策略限制对建筑的物理访问。在第二篇文章中,我将重点讨论安全摄像头的连接性、将数据流式传输到 Azure IoT 中心、触发授权流,并使用内置在 Azure 机器学习中的异常检测服务评估潜在入侵的严重性。

    02
    领券